Lollapalooza SP Festival Organizers Accused of Hiring Slave Labor

By Lise Alves, Senior Contributing Reporter

SÃO PAULO, BRAZIL – Men living in homeless shelters were hired by entertainment company Time For Fun (T4F) for R$50 per day to set up the stages and move heavy equipment for the Lollapalooza Festival which took place last weekend in São Paulo, claim an entertainment workers' union in São Paulo. According to the union, this could be considered modern-day slave labor.
